First play was a pass, I drop back as the QB, find a receiver running a post, I side step a DE, throw the ball in over the hands of a CB going for the pick, hits my receiver in the chest and just as it happens a safety nails him in the face and the ball flies up into the air and gets intercepted, and it all looked amazing.
Even though the play was a bad result for my team, it was amazing.
So far aftering playing through the 2 2 minute quarters you're allowed, I have decided that the game is a good blend between APF 2k8 and Madden.
It doesn't try to be the super detailed football sim that 2k8 is, but due to the physics engine it is as close to truly real football as you will see until the next Backbreaker comes out.
It's a ton of fun to play and requires a lot of skill which is what everybody wants from a football game. The emphasis on outsmarting your opponent like in 2k8 isn't really there, it's more about stick skill, but it's so much fun to play that I like it.
One thing I do hope though is that there are more plays in the final game. The selection seems to be limited, however based on what I've seen in other videos, there are far more plays in the actual game than the demo, so I'm not too worried.
